The Landmarks That Make This Tour Special

Hadrian’s Gate
The tour’s highlight for many is Hadrian’s Gate, a Roman triumphal arch that commemorates Emperor Hadrian’s visit in 130 AD. It’s breathtaking to stand beneath the arches and imagine the thousands of years of history embedded in its stones. Reviewers noted it’s “an awe-inspiring sight” and “a perfect photo stop.”
The Clock Tower
Next, the Clock Tower, from 1901, offers a glimpse into more recent history. It’s a perfect example of Ottoman-era architecture and serves as a central meeting point. Many appreciate the well-preserved condition and the charming surroundings.

The Yivli Minaret Mosque
The Yivli Minaret Mosque, a 14th-century structure with its distinctive fluted minaret, is one of Antalya’s most recognizable symbols. Its historical significance and striking design make it a must-see, and visitors often comment on how impressive it looks standing tall amid the bustling streets.
Hdrlk Tower and Coastal Views
Finally, the Hdrlk Tower, a Roman watchtower, offers sweeping views of the coastline, perfect for photo opportunities. Many travelers appreciate the chance to see Antalya from a different angle, especially as the tower’s vantage point overlooks the shimmering sea.

Practical Details and Tips for the Tour

Meeting point is clearly defined at Hadrian’s Gate, where your guide, easily recognizable in a red “Payless Travel” T-shirt, will be waiting. Arrive on time to avoid missing the start, as the tour begins promptly at 10:00 AM.
Inclusions are limited to exterior visits and a professional guide, making it a straightforward, budget-friendly option. The cost covers the 2-hour walk, with the boat trip available for an additional €10, providing good value considering the scope of sights covered.
What to bring? Comfortable shoes are a must—Antalya’s cobbled streets can be uneven—plus a camera to capture the scenery, and light clothing suitable for the weather.
Accessibility & suitability: The tour isn’t suitable for children under 5, pregnant women, or those with mobility impairments, as it involves walking through historic, sometimes uneven streets. It’s best for those who enjoy a paced, informative walk.
